Review by Horn Book Review

Beginning with birth, these books follow an animal's development, detailing physical attributes, habitat, diet, and behavior, as well as adult life, including hunting techniques and mating and parenting habits. Also discussed are threats to the animals' survival. Large, captioned color photographs adorn every page, and sidebars and diagrams add both visual and instructional value. Bib., glos., ind.
